-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h has ordered revision of overlapping regulations and building of a job-position framework as the basis for appropriate staffing to consolidate the two-tier local government system in November.

Presiding the Government meeting on the implementation of the two-tier local government model in Hanoi on October 29, PM Chinh hailed ministries, sectors, and localities’ efforts in operating the streamlined apparatus which has shown improvements in public service delivery. However, he pointed out ongoing institutional obstacles and human resources gaps, highlighting some grassroots public servants and officials lack professional expertise, management skills, legal knowledge, and digital understanding. -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h has signed Decision No. 2400/QD-TTg approving an emergency relief package worth 350 billion VND (13.2 million USD) to support Hue City and the central provinces of Quang Tri and Quang Ngai in recovering from severe flooding triggered by recent heavy rains.

The funds, drawn from the 2025 central budget reserve, will help localities meet urgent needs and restore livelihoods, according to the Ministry of Finance (MoF). Hue will receive 150 billion VND, while Quang Tri and Quang Ngai will each receive 100 billion VND, based on the ministry’s proposal submitted on October 29. Read full story

- The Chairperson of the Ho Chi Minh City People’s Committee has endorsed a proposal to shift the starting point of the Can Gio metro line from Tan Thuan Station to Ben Thanh Station, enabling a direct connection with metro line No.1 (Ben Thanh–Suoi Tien).

The committee's office announced on October 29 said the proposal was discussed at a meeting of the city’s special task force for reviewing and resolving issues related to major projects and land sites across the city. Read full story./.
